Panic Attacks
Sudden episodes of intense fear or anxiety, often accompanied by physical symptoms like heart palpitations, shortness of breath, and dizziness.
Anti-psychotic Medication
Drugs used to treat psychiatric conditions by regulating brain chemicals, often used in the management of schizophrenia, bipolar disorder, and other mental health issues.
Generalized Anxiety Disorder (GAD)
A mental health disorder characterized by persistent and excessive worry about various aspects of life.
